Martin Audio CDD takes Centre Stage

HONG KONG: SI and sales company Man Sing has supplied and installed a Martin Audio CDD (Coaxial Differential Dispersion) system into Centre Stage, Wan Chai. The bar and live music venue joins the lineup of watering holes along the legendary Jaffe Road, and is located next door to one of the owner’s existing establishments, Dusk ‘Til Dawn.

Centre Stage was set up with the intention of providing the best possible audio quality and this, according to the venue’s sound engineer Julius Bernales, is why the CDD system was chosen.

‘We hope that the sound will set us apart from all the other bars in this part of Hong Kong,’ said Mr Bernales. ‘Some of our friends from the Philippines recommended Martin’s CDD system as they are using it there, so we told our boss we’d like to try it too. Martin Audio has a very good reputation, and we knew it was a good brand for live sound.

‘For me, the Martin sound is very soft and warm, and as we are mainly putting on live music, we didn’t want anything too harsh, like a pure club system. However, we will have DJs alternating with the bands, and the CDD is good for this too. Now it’s been installed we really like the sound in the new venue, and so does the owner.’

Centre Stage is owned by Step By Step, which has five other bars throughout Hong Kong. ‘We have been around for 10 years and have worked on lots of bars in Wan Chai, Central and Lan Kwai Fong,’ continued Mr Bernales.

As with most Hong Kong bars, space at Centre Stage is at a premium, requiring just four CDD12 passive two-way speakers to be mounted above the stage to cover the entire venue, with a further two onstage for monitoring. Two CSX112 compact subwoofers have been concealed beneath the stage behind a grille. The system, which was sold by distributor, Pacific Budee Technology, is powered by four Crown 6000 Series amplifiers.

This is the first CDD system Man Sing has installed. ‘Before this installation we had used the F Series extensively, and we think the CDD sound is even more clear and powerful than Martin’s previous models,’ says Man Sing’s Ricky Wong. ‘We are very happy with the speakers; as well as sounding great they are easy to work with. They are compact in size, with small subwoofers, and this is very important here in Hong Kong.

‘With this installation we now have somewhere we can bring our customers to listen to the new system.’
